André FILION was born 27 April 1780 in Saint-Joachim, Montmorency, Province of Québec, Canada

André FILION was the child of André FILION   and   Marie-Fortunée GIRARD and the grandchild of: (paternal)  Paul FILION and Marie-Josephte TREMBLAY (maternal)  Pierre GIRARD and Marie-Anne VÉZINA

Spouse(s)/Partner(s) and Child(ren):

André  married  Euphrosine TREMBLAY 22 April 1804 in Baie-Saint-Paul, Lower Canada .  The couple had (at least) 7 children.
Euphrosine TREMBLAY  was born 16 February 1780 in Les Éboulements, Québec, Canada (Notre-Dame-de-l'Assomption-des-Eboulements).  Euphrosine died 27 May 1817 in La Malbaie, Québec, Canada (Murray Bay) (Saint-Etienne-de-la-Malbaie) (Saint-Fidèle) (Pointe-au-Pic).  Euphrosine was the child of Etienne-Dominique TREMBLAY and Therese GAGNE.

André  married  (2) Apolline TREMBLAY 5 May 1818 in La Malbaie, Lower Canada .  The couple had (at least) 6 children.
Apolline TREMBLAY  was born 9 February 1792 in Les Éboulements, Québec, Canada (Notre-Dame-de-l'Assomption-des-Eboulements).  Apolline died 12 November 1839 in Matane, Québec, Canada (Saint-Jérôme-de-Matane).  Apolline was the child of Joseph-Marie TREMBLAY and Marie-Anne IMBEAULT dite LAGRANGE.

André FILION died 15 November 1839 in Matane, Lower Canada .

Occupation

André FILION was a forgeron.
A forgeron, or blacksmith, was primarily a craftsman of wrought iron on the anvil. Protecting himself with a thick leather apron, he used a bellows (first made of leather, then wood and finally metal) to push the air that fuelled the coal fire of the forge, a type of cast iron table where the iron was reddened... Using pliers of various sizes to hold the hot iron, the blacksmith would then give it a specific shape with the help of different hammers. The blacksmith made farm instruments, vehicle accessories and even schooners, cemetery crosses, steel bandages, hooks for hay bales, etc.

Did You Know? Québec Généalogie - Over time, Québec has gone through a series of name changes
From its inception in the early 1600s until 1760, it was called Canada, New France.
1760 to 1763, it was simply Canada
1763 to 1791 - Province of Québec
1791 to 1867 - Lower Canada
1867 to present - Québec, Canada.
